In September 2011, following T47, we will hold our regular TD meeting.
Players as well as staff members (TDs, programmers, guardian angels) are invited to provide suggestions for changes and constructive input.

One suggestion to consider is to not list teams entered until after the deadline.
On the plus side, it would eliminate the unlikely but possible opportunity for teams to manipulate their lineups to somehow gain an advantage in team sections.
On the negative side, not seeing who has already been recruited or joined to a team may lead to some players being added to teams within the same section by captains.

wouldn't it be nice to see a few more quality endgames? otb, players get an endgame time bonus, whereas in teamleague we usually have to blitz out our endgames, because of time trouble.
on fics, the "moretime" command has to be issued by the players and is currently forbidden in teamleague. but perhaps seberg could work out something that makes teamleague (td) add 22:30 minutes to both clocks on move 45? (i know it is 30 minutes on move 40 in fide, but we are teamleague, aren't we?). such change would affect perhaps 10-20 % of all tl games, the others end earlier.
adding a total of 45 minutes to the game will not destroy anyone's weekend timeline while allowing to take a breath and formulate an endgame plan at some point.

Out of 100 most recent 45 45 games on FICS 21 ended after 45th move, so would be affected by your change. In only 4 of these games the losing player had less than 10 minutes on the clock at the end of the game. So I don't think the change would make a big difference.
Reading an intermediate book on chess endings would make a big difference though :).

Here is a belated summary of the TD meeting following T47.
* Not entering teams until after the deadline: there was a consensus that it is difficult enough to get an advantage by manipulating teams at the last minute, so no change is necessary.
* Changing the time control: consensus not to change it.
* Automated deadline reminders: there was a consensus for this change. As of this writing I have implemented it and it seems to be working.
* RR penalty for players who miss a game and renegotiate: no consensus, so no change. However, there was a consensus to make RR more visible and understandable to users, and to encourage TDs to use the player comment function.
* Disconnectors list: there was a consensus to clarify the rules relating to disconnections, but no consensus for any other change.
* Interested teams list: jaber said he would talk to the programmers.
* Website editor: jaberwock and I talked in private. I have been given access to edit the website, and I have added a history page and a list of champions.
The meeting closed with the customary singing of the TL anthem.
